The LanskySoft-Grip Dual Thumb Screw Knife Clamp (RCLAMP) is a precision sharpening accessory designed to hold knives securely at four adjustable angles (17°, 20°, 25°, 30°). Compatible with all Lansky sharpening systems, it features soft rubber jaws to prevent blade scratching and dual thumb screws for easy, tool-free operation. Lightweight and compact, it’s ideal for maintaining professional-grade edges on kitchen and fixed blades up to 7 inches long.

I recently purchased a Lansky Diamond stone sharpening system so I could profile my household and pocket knives consistently. Before the purchase, I did considerable research. One of the YouTube videos I saw mentioned this clamp. The advantage of this clamp over the one that's supplied with the kit is twofold. First, the jaws of the clamp have small foam pads glued in that allows you to clamp the knife without marring/discoloring the blade. Second, the screws supplied with this clamp have a plastic cap that allows you to tighten them more easily than the ones on the supplied clamp. That second advantage is also a disadvantage when sharpening at a low bevel angle. The plastic cap gets in the way of the hone.The clamp does what it was designed to do. However, the plastic cap getting in the way is why this is only a 4 star review. I had to purchase 4 10x24 (thread count per inch) screws to replace the supplied capped screws. These allow me to sharpen a Santoku knife at 17 degree bevel angle without interference from the clamping screws.You don't have to have the clamp to sharpen knives because the supplied clamp will do it just as well (after changing the screws out) if you put a small piece of blue masking tape on the knife blade where you clamp the knife for sharpening.Overall it works but Lansky needs to ensure the capped screws are short enough to not get in the way.

Having the thumb screw rather than just a slotted screw is great !
Having the thumb screw in place of the regular slotted screw is great ! It makes it much easier to adjust for the blade thickness without trying to hold a screw driver while trying to keep everything else steady.
